DIY Olive Oil Moisturize For Dry Skin In Summer

Use sugar and olive oil to combine to make a scrub that naturally moisturizes while exfoliating. This combination of organic components gives you smooth, nourished skin by removing dryness and dead skin cells.

Ingredients

  • Refined Sugar - 1/4 cup
  • Virgin Olive Oil - 2 Tablespoons
  • Lavender Oil - 2 Drops

Recipe

  1. Add two tablespoons of olive oil with ¼ th cup of refined Sugar to make a paste.
  2. Include, if desired, essential oil, like lavender, which has a natural aroma and can help you unwind.
  3. Apply the scrub gently to your skin, then wash it off.
  4. Lastly, seal the advantages of recently exfoliated skin by applying a soothing moisturizer.

Homemade Oatmeal Honey Mask To Moisturize Dry Skin In Summer

Oatmeal works well as a mask or exfoliant. Your skin takes in a lot of toxins every day, and this formula helps to detoxify the body while also making the skin softer and plumper.

Ingredients

  • Powdered Oats - 2 Tablespoons
  • Honey - 1 Tablespoon

Recipe

  1. Combine powdered oats with honey, and sprinkle water to make a smooth paste.
  2. Warm the mixture and rub the warm liquid into your skin.
  3. You can use it as a simple exfoliant and wash it off immediately away, or you can use it as a calming, hydrating mask and leave it on for 15 to 20 minutes.

Daily Tips & Tricks

  • Create A Routine For Moisturizing: It is advised to apply moisturizer regularly to protect your skin from environmental damage and to increase its hydration levels.
  • Avoid Wrong Bathing Practices: Skin-friendly bathing practices include avoiding hot showers and keeping baths to 10 minutes. Regular bar soap may contain harsh ingredients on your skin; instead, look for natural soaps, gentle cleansers, or liquid body wash.
  • Go Natural: Avoid using products with harsh chemicals, such as alcohol and apple cider vinegar. Get an organic moisturizer suitable for your skin if you need to improve at DIY projects. These substances can exacerbate dry skin and even result in burns in some.
  • Increase Your Water Intake: Drinking more water helps your body stay hydrated and moisturizes your skin from the inside out. The best technique to increase skin moisture is through this.
  • Dress Appropriately For The Weather: This extends beyond using sunscreen in the summer to help prevent sunburn and skin cancer. To avoid dryness and chapping, remember to wear gloves before venturing outside in the winter.
